1.10 — Grupy obliczeniowe w dodatku Dynamo
Last updated
Last updated
W tym rozdziale wykorzystamy moc obliczeniową dodatku Dynamo, aby umieścić i zmodyfikować elastyczne grupy powiązane z przykładami wykresów OOTB Dynamo.
Jeśli ostatnia sekcja nie została ukończona, pobierz i otwórz plik 1.10 – Computational Groups with Dynamo.axm z zestawów danych FormIt Primer Part 1 Datasets.
Więcej informacji na temat sposobu współpracy programu FormIt z dodatkiem Dynamo w procesach roboczych projektowania obliczeniowego można znaleźć tutaj.
1 — Upewnij się, że warstwy Lower Terrace, Main Building Floor i Plan Image są włączone, ponieważ właśnie tam zostaną dodane schody.
2 — Aby umieścić grupę schodów powiązaną z jednym z przykładów OOTB Dynamo Samples:
Otwórz paletę Dynamo na pasku palet. W katalogu Dynamo Samples powinno być widocznych kilka wbudowanych obiektów dodatku Dynamo.
Kliknij raz przykład dodatku Dynamo Stairs, aby przenieść go do obszaru modelu. Program FormIt uruchomi wykres w tle i na podstawie tego wykresu wygeneruje geometrię schodów.
Przesuń kursor na obszar rysunku. Po wczytaniu schodów półprzezroczysty podgląd ich geometrii będzie przesuwał się wraz ze wskaźnikiem myszy. Przesuń kursor na obszar rysunku w pobliżu tarasu i kliknij, aby umieścić tam schody. Naciśnij klawisz Esc, aby usunąć zaznaczenie. Zwróć uwagę, że po umieszczeniu schodów automatycznie zostanie otwarta paleta Właściwości.
Uwaga: Możesz również dołączać katalogi lokalne zawierające wykresy Dynamo i uruchamiać własne lokalne wykresy Dynamo, podobnie jak w tych przykładach.
3 — Aby zaktualizować wymiary schodów:
Po wybraniu grupy schodów zmodyfikuj dane wejściowe dostępne w sekcji INPUTS dodatku Dynamo u dołu palety Właściwości, aby były zgodne z poniższą ilustracją. Po wybraniu większości grup utworzonych za pomocą skryptów Dynamo w ich właściwościach znajduje się sekcja dodatku Dynamo.
Add Top Landing = False
Add Middle Landing = False
Add Bottom Landing = False
Floor-to-Floor Height = 2,6
Stair Width = 12
Riser Height = 0,6
Tread Length = 1,25
Tread Overlap = 0,25
Tread Thickness = 0,25
Height Between Middle Landings = (nie dotyczy, ponieważ nie jest tworzony środkowy podest)
Middle Landing Length = (nie dotyczy, ponieważ nie jest tworzony środkowy podest)
Top/Bottom Landing Length = (nie dotyczy, ponieważ nie jest tworzony żaden podest)
Kliknij przycisk Run, aby uruchomić ponownie skrypt Dynamo przy użyciu zaktualizowanych wartości danych wejściowych.
Przesuń grupę odpowiednio do potrzeb, aby umieścić schody we właściwym położeniu zgodnie z warstwą Plan Image. Uważaj, aby podczas przesuwania nie zmienić rzędnej grupy schodów. Więcej na temat sztuczek i technik stosowanych podczas przesuwania elementów modelu można dowiedzieć się z poprzednich rozdziałów.
Uwaga : Dane wejściowe Floor-to-Floor Height to przybliżona wartość całkowitej wysokości schodów. Parametr Riser Height faktycznie definiuje wysokość schodów. W tym przykładzie ustawiamy wartość parametru Floor-to-Floor Height na 2,6’, ale ostateczna wysokość schodów wynosi 3,0’: 0,6’ (Riser Height) x 5 (liczba podstopnic). Ponieważ rozpiętość między podłożem a górną powierzchnią stropu tarasu wynosi 3’-2”, pozostałe 2” znajdują się w górnej podstopnicy.
W poprzednich krokach utworzyliśmy schody bez podestów. Teraz utworzymy schody korzystające z górnego podestu dopasowanego do warstwy Main Building Floor.
1 — Zacznij od utworzenia kopii właśnie utworzonych schodów:
Wybierz istniejące schody, a następnie kliknij w dowolnym miejscu na warstwie Plan Image, aby uruchomić polecenie przesuwania. Spowoduje to, że program FormIt użyje rzędnej warstwy Plan Image jako początkowej wysokości odniesienia do umieszczenia nowej kopii. Naciśnij klawisz Ctrl, aby utworzyć szybką kopię.
Przesuń kursor bliżej głównego budynku powyżej tarasu. Zwróć uwagę, że teraz górna powierzchnia tarasu jest nową płaszczyzną odniesienia. Kliknij, aby umieścić grupę.
Uwaga: Ponieważ warstwa Plan Image znajduje się na płaszczyźnie Ground Level narzędzie Przesuń będzie używało tej płaszczyzny jako odniesienia dla punktu początkowego. Na powyższej ilustracji zwróć uwagę na etykietkę narzędzia On Face wskazującą, że jako odniesienie początkowe została wybrana powierzchnia warstwy Plan Image, a jako odniesienie końcowe — górna powierzchnia warstwy Lower Terrace Floor .
2 — Użyj narzędzia Ustaw jako niepowtarzalne (MU), aby zmiana danych wejściowych tych schodów w dodatku Dynamo nie wpłynęła na dolne schody. Zmień położenie grupy odpowiednio do potrzeb, aby znajdowała się ona blisko położenia końcowego — dostosujemy to później. Możesz przełączyć widoczność warstwy Lower Terrace, aby wyświetlić poniższy rzut, co ułatwi jego umieszczenie, ale uważaj, aby nie zmienić rzędnej nowych schodów podczas ich przesuwania.
3 — Na palecie Właściwości zaktualizuj dane Dynamo Inputs, jak pokazano poniżej, i jeszcze raz uruchom skrypt.
Add Top Landing = True
Floor-to-Floor Height = 2,333
Riser Height = 0,466
Tread Length = 1,5
Top/Bottom Landing Length = 2,5
Uwaga: Jeśli ustawisz dla parametru Add Bottom Landing wartość True i uruchomisz ponownie skrypt, górna powierzchnia dolnego podestu powinna pasować do górnej powierzchni warstwy Lower Terrace Floor. Dzieje się tak, ponieważ — w odróżnieniu od poprzednich schodów — dopasowaliśmy parametr Riser Height do rzeczywistej wysokości parametru Floor-to-Floor Height , jaką chcemy uzyskać (2’-4” lub 2,333’).
2 — Ponownie zmień położenie grupy na końcowe. Górny podest powinien być równoległy do warstwy Main Building Floor.
3 — Aby zakończyć tworzenie schodów, dodaj do nich materiał Stone — Travertine, aby dopasować go do kondygnacji. Więcej informacji na temat sposobu stosowania materiałów można znaleźć w poprzednich rozdziałach.